If Y2K wasn’t a problem then why did companies waste billions of dollars to upgrade systems and thousands of man hours on it?

Isn’t what you and so many that like to bring up T2K saying a lot like say the Weather service makes a river flood crest warning of 29 feet the leeve is only 28 feet so the National Gaurd, Corp of Engineers, residents and hundreds of voluteers spend days filling sand bags to raise the leeve to 30 feet they get it to 29 1/2 foot the river crest at 29 foot and the flooding is avoided. So now you make fun of the Weather service because there was no flood? There was no flood because there was a WARNING and people then heeded that warning and took action to prevent a disaster.
